For two months Green Bay Packer fans have been trying to come to terms as to what Aaron Rodgers will decide to do next season. The two options are either retire or continue to play. If Aaron decides the latter, will it be with Green Bay? That is when Brian Gutekunst steps in. Throughout the offseason, we have heard Gutekunst express his confidence in Jordan Love, but also stating that he wants Aaron Rodgers back. This here is when things start to get dicey and confusing:
Brian Gutekunst Cannot Have Both On The Roster

Jordan Love is heading into his fourth year in the NFL. and has a little to no profile to show. For a player like Love, who was a first round draft pick, the time to show his worth is fading as each game and year go by. On the other hand, Aaron Rodgers still has meaningful football that he can play. That is where things get messy. Brian Gutekunst has to to decide whether winning right now is the most important thing, or is making sure his project quarterback works out the way he hoped. Make no mistake about it, Jordan Love deserves his chance to play; and quite frankly needs to play this year. Will it be with Green Bay or another team? That is the question that needs to be answered, and honeslty, needs to be answered quickly. Based on what we have heard all offseason, signs, to me, indicate that Green Bay wants to move on with Jordan Love.
Free Agency And The NFL Draft Need To Be At The Forefront

For as talented as a team that Green Bay has despite an 8-9 record, there are quite a few holes that need to be filled via free agency and the NFL Draft. The NFL Scouting Combine began this week, which gives coaches and general managers a first glance at prospective talent. This is where Brian Gutekunst’s focus needs to be right now and for the next two months. There is not much time to deal with other situations on the team as interviews with players and free agent meetings are going to take up a chunk of time up to the end of May. If Green Bay is certain that Jordan Love has what it takes to play, then it is time to give him the opportunity. It is important to address free agency and the draft and build around a team’s quarterback to give them the best chance to succeed. This is also the reason why the urgency on fixing the quarterback situation needs to be a little bit higher than continuing to wait.
The Ball Is In Brian Gutekunst’s Court
Brian Gutekunst has the ability to cut and trade players. No player has any higher authority than a general manager. As stated above, Guetkunst has spoken extremely high of Jordan Love this offseason. The question is: what is holding him back? He could very much be extra cautious on this decision and wants to do it together with Aaron Rodgers. That might be the most likely scenario. However, could it also be that Brian is not comfortable moving on from Aaron Rodgers and knows the team could struggle worse for the next couple seasons? Maybe he does not want to have that situation on his hands. Who knows what the actual situation is. In the end, time is ticking away and Green Bay needs to find a solution on this dilemma. Whether it is Aaron Rodgers at the helm, or Jordan Love as the new guy in town, it is time for Brian Gutekunst to make a decision.
